One of the other lab speakers at Catalyst West was Blake Mycoskie, Chief Shoe Giver at Tom’s Shoes. I’m wearing a pair of Tom’s shoes this weekend as an illustration in the Influence series. Blake was touring Argentina in 2006 when he noticed how many kids didn’t have shoes. He decided to do something about it. He started Tom’s shoes with a simple premise: for every pair of shoes they sell they give a pair of shoes to a child in a third world country. So simple. So brilliant. Blake went back to Argentina later in 2006 and gave away 10,000 pairs of shoes!

To date they’ve given away 140,000 pairs of shoes!
